A LARGE JIAN 'HARE'S-FUR' CONICAL TEA BOWL, SOUTHERN SONG DYNASTY (1127-1279)
A LARGE JIAN 'HARE'S-FUR' CONICAL TEA BOWL
SOUTHERN SONG DYNASTY (1127-1279)
The bowl is potted with flaring sides rising to a slightly everted rim bound with a metal band. The interior and exterior are covered with a lustrous black glaze streaked with fine russet 'hare's-fur' markings which pools irregularly above the foot which has fired to a dark purplish-brown color.
6 ¼ in. (15.8 cm.) diam., Japanese wood box
